Output 354a8153848a2f5b38c6f19c380565e9cf551814cc6023708de150d8764a9672:7

value
43059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57934cb1660fea6c97a67fbf0dcf99fc97bdc0b2 OP_EQUAL
address
39g5Ancyj6BzJxyX3EFeGtSgFayzE5N8BB
transaction
354a8153848a2f5b38c6f19c380565e9cf551814cc6023708de150d8764a9672